Anna German is an illustrator and art teacher whose picture book, So When Are You Going to Have Kids?, explains what it feels like to be asked that question when you are trying to conceive. We talk to her about how she drew creative inspiration from her five-year struggle. Meanwhile, Liz and Nick are coming to terms with using donor eggs, while Professor Tim addresses sleep: does it affect fertility?
